Meet Me In Bombay by Jenny Ashcroft

article image placeholderMeet Me In Bombay
Yeah, it breaks your heart in a million times. And it's just your classic love triangle and all that, as they call it, Bollywood masala is what they call it. And it's a romance kind of a thing. It's set in the pre World War One times in Bombay, India, and it's kind of neat that way. I liked it
